Monday was a chaotic start to the work week when hundreds of companies suffered outages related to using Amazon AWS. Elizabeth Warren put the company on blast, declaring the incident a wake up call.

Taking to social media, Warren highlighted the dangers of being too reliant on one company. Warren suggested that the incident proved that Amazon has too much of a stranglehold in the tech industry.

“If a company can break the entire internet, they are too big. Period. It’s time to break up Big Tech,” Warren wrote on X.
